How to Manually Unlock All Characters
To unlock superstars without using external files, you must complete specific tasks within the WWE Universe and Road to WrestleMania (RTWM) modes. WWE Universe & RTWM Unlockables
Many characters are unlocked by winning matches in Universe mode, such as Brie Bella and Nikki Bella (Divas championships), Ezekiel Jackson (5 Superstars matches), Goldust (10 RAW matches), and Shelton Benjamin (10 SmackDown matches). Key legends in Road to WrestleMania include Jake "The Snake" Roberts and The Rock (Vs. Undertaker) and Ricky Steamboat (Christian's story). Completing all five RTWM stories unlocks the Druid.
